Electus Backus was born in New York in 1804. He was the son of Colonel Electus Backus who was killed at Sackett's Harbor in the War of 1812. The younger Backus graduated from West Point in 1824 and fought in the Seminole and the Mexican wars. He was brevetted major after the Battle of Monterrey and in 1847 was in command of the troops garrisoning Castle of San Juan de Ulloa at Veracruz, Mexico. In June 1850, Backus, who was Major of the 3rd U.S. Infantry, was assigned command of Fort Defiance, Arizona. Backus died in Detroit in June 1862, just after he was appointed Colonel of the 6th U.S. Infantry.
